TaxiDriver Posted December 19, 2013 Share Posted December 19, 2013 What some people do is have a little piece of DRY Mr. Clean Magic Eraser near their turntable and dip the stylus in a couple times vertically to get the dust. Works good I've tried it myself but YMMV.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
russtcb Posted December 19, 2013 Share Posted December 19, 2013 Magic Eraser has worked out fine for me. Just placing it under the tone arm and using the level to take it up and down a few times.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

ajxd Posted December 19, 2013 Share Posted December 19, 2013 As for the Magic Eraser, yes its better than your fingers. BUT. As I've stated before in other threads... there have been some posts where people put their stylus down on the eraser... then lifted it, and noticed there was a small black spec on the magic eraser, and no diamond tip on the stylus. Never happened to me, could be the idiot slammed his stylus into the eraser. But, be careful.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
